In this deeply personal episode, I share a powerful dream where I stood face-to-face with my dad after so many years. For the first time, I was able to break free from my shell and express how his choices have shaped my daily life—the sadness they bring and the weight I’ve carried. Since his passing, I’ve found myself questioning whether I deserve to feel moments of pure, genuine happiness. Join me as I navigate the complexities of grief, self-discovery, and finding light in the shadows.
